Hairy Dreams is inspired by Lina Cruz's fascination for dreams, altered states, homelessness and what she finds they paradoxically have in common: access to an immense sense of freedom. Hairy Dreams evokes the interior world of a lonesome yet nonchalant character. Through words and movement, this is a visual abstract tale, taking place in a white cave-like space made of paper. Within this sort of origami igloo, a surrealist puzzle of images reveals the everyday routine of an androgynous character. Through various disparate actions, the character assembles and disassembles repeatedly its interior translucent world. In this quest of an interior castle, time is always present, haunting yet of precious companionship.
